Heat conduction (or thermal conduction) is the movement of heat from one solid to another one that has different temperature when they are touching each other.
Thermal Equilibrium
Two objects which are in thermal contact can exchange heat energy between them.
The heat energy is transferred from the object with a higher temperature to the object with a lower temperature
